Output 80d7c72cfe89ffc32bf5a2172c042b161f22e1be8d86b374513ddfc8db59dabf:0

value
1378755
script pubkey
OP_0 OP_PUSHBYTES_20 d608e877515a8dc3b650c5e121f4b4cc71a3ea9a
address
bc1q6cywsa63t2xu8djschsjra95e3c68656eh2866
transaction
80d7c72cfe89ffc32bf5a2172c042b161f22e1be8d86b374513ddfc8db59dabf
spent
true